Overview Connections Playback ENGLISH Connecting multiple PM-KI RUBY units (F.C.B.S. connection) The Marantz F.C.B.S. (Floating Control Bus System) is the high quality sound system for link control between multiple PM-KI RUBY units (up to 4 units). Each unit is controlled via its ID number registered beforehand. The ID numbers need to be set to an operating unit (master) and a subordinate unit (slave) receiving the command from the master. For slave units, register ID numbers in the order of command reception from the master. ID numbers can be set for units connected by F.C.B.S. to perform linked operations such as switching the input source, adjusting the volume, muting, adjusting the volume balance, adjusting the sound quality and trimming the display brightness. Furthermore, F.C.B.S. connection of multiple PM-KI RUBY units has the feature that switches this unit's output from stereo to monaural so that the unit can works as a monaural output amplifier. Follow the respective instructions to make the necessary settings. Preparation for F.C.B.S. connection n Making the F.C.B.S. connection To use multiple PM-KI RUBY units, make this connection in addition to audio connection. For details on each connection feature, refer to the respective instructions. 0 "Stereo complete bi-amp connection" (v p. 11) 0 "Connection for 5.1 Multi-channel Playback" (v p. 13) Prepare the correct number of portable audio connection cables for the number of units to be connected. Either of the following types of connection cables are adequate. 0 Φ3.5 Monaural mini plug O N Φ3.5 monaural mini plug connecting cable . 0 Φ3.5 Stereo mini plug O N Φ3.5 stereo mini plug connecting cable . NOTE 0 Do not use connecting cables that contain resistance. n Connection example In the connection of the following example, an unit with ID number 1 acts as a master amplifier to control all the other slave units with ID numbers 2 to 4.
